    Massive Sand Flea Swarm Blankets Florida Beach

    Satellite Beach, Florida, experienced an unusual sight recently: a massive swarm of sand fleas covered a section of the beach. Denise Derrick Wright, a longtime beachgoer, captured the event on video and shared it with Sky News. "I've never seen anything like it," Wright stated. Experts confirmed that the sand fleas, while numerous, pose no threat to humans. These tiny crustaceans are common in sandy areas and emerge at night to feed on decaying seaweed. The video offers a unique perspective on this natural phenomenon, highlighting the unexpected occurrences in nature and the beauty of the natural world.
